WebDamper is a bread made from wheat -based dough. Flour, salt and water, with some butter if available, is lightly kneaded and baked in the coals of a campfire, either directly or within a camp oven. WebMay 6, 2024 · Unlike sourdough, where keeping starter alive is a worry, "damper has always been the simplest thing", she says. "You can make damper out of the cheapest flour out there and it'll still be delicious."
